In a staggering display of dominance, Kenya Police defeated Mathare United FC 5-0 in their recent Premier League encounter. The match’s turning point came early, with Kenya Police taking the lead within the first 12 minutes. This early goal set the tone for the match, giving the away team the confidence to press further and control the game decisively.

Kenya Police's offensive prowess was evident, with a remarkable five goals scored from a combination of strategic play and clinical finishing. Each goal was timed to dent Mathare United's morale further, with the first two goals coming in the first half and an additional three in the second half. The timing of these goals, particularly the quick succession of the third and fourth goals early in the second half, effectively crushed any hopes Mathare United had of staging a comeback.

Statistically, Kenya Police dominated with nine corner kicks compared to Mathare United's zero. This disparity highlights the continuous pressure and territorial advantage maintained by the away team. Additionally, with Mathare United’s sole red card, their numerical disadvantage further exacerbated their struggle to compete effectively. The discipline, or lack thereof, was another key factor; Mathare United’s red card in the second half compounded their woes and allowed Kenya Police even more space to exploit.

Moreover, the solitary yellow cards for both teams indicate a relatively disciplined approach, with the notable exception of the red card incident. Kenya Police's ability to stay composed and exploit Mathare United's vulnerabilities after the latter received their red card was critical. This underscores the strategic and tactical superiority displayed by Kenya Police, both in maintaining discipline and capitalizing on every opportunity.

In conclusion, Kenya Police's systematic approach, high number of corner kicks, and tactical superiority were pivotal in their 5-0 victory. Mathare United's inability to muster any corner kicks and subsequent lapse in discipline, reflected by their red card, were significant factors in their defeat.
